US President does not rule out direct meeting with Iranian officials, while hinting at possible deal

United States Vice President JD Vance, along with the American delegation participating in peace talks with Iran, have left for Pakistan and are expected to arrive within a few hours.

President Donald Trump stated this on Monday in an interview with the New York Post, adding that he is willing to meet with senior Iranian officials if progress is achieved in negotiations.

In another interview with Fox News, Trump went further, stating that a deal with Tehran could be signed "as soon as today."

" The talks are expected to take place ," Trump said, dismissing speculation that the negotiations had failed. " At this stage, I don't believe anyone is playing games ," he added.

The president confirmed that a high-level US delegation, including Vice President JD Vance, special envoy Steve Witkoff and adviser Jared Kushner, is headed to Islamabad for the next round of talks.

" They're already on the way. They'll be there tonight ," Trump declared.

This development underscores the urgency of the negotiations, which take place just days before the end of the ceasefire between the US and Iran, at a time of heightened tension in the region.

Trump left open the possibility of a significant diplomatic move, stressing that he does not rule out a direct meeting with the Iranian leadership.

" I have no problem meeting them. If they want to meet, we have very capable people, but I have no problem meeting them ," he said.

According to him, the main US demand remains unchanged: Iran must abandon any efforts to develop nuclear weapons.

" Give up nuclear weapons. It's very simple. There will be no nuclear weapons," Trump said. He added that Iran could prosper if it met that condition. "Otherwise, it's a wonderful country, it could really become one ," he declared.

However, the US president did not provide details on the possible consequences if Tehran refuses to meet the demands or if the talks fail, especially on the eve of the end of the ceasefire.

" I don't want to go into details. You can imagine it yourself. It wouldn't be a good thing ," he said when asked about the possibility of escalating the measures.

Asked if the US knows who is representing Iran in the negotiations, Trump replied: "We have a pretty clear idea and we believe we are talking to the right people."
